Context

The QPN paper is getting published. We want people to be able to discover the QPN dataset.

Why

  • More visibility for QPN data
  • Make it as easy as possible for folks interested in QPN to learn about the dataset
  • Ensure that users have an easy time for working with the d

Outcomes

users can

  • find info on subject level about QPN
  • subjectID, availability of tools and imaging + derivatives can be included in query result download
  • query result download should include subjectID so users can later filter the full dataset after getting access (for now manually, later maybe via datalad)
  • users can also query on age and sex (need to clarify if these can be included in the downloaded results)
  • the query results download includes the link to the data portal URL (in addition to being represented on the UI)
  • the QPN node itself is up to date with the current dataset and also fully searchable (pay attention to the vocabulary for assessment tools currently supported by the public tools)
